摘要

目的通过对慢性不可预测轻度应激(CUMS)大鼠进行为期4周的有氧运动干预,建立抑郁模型,探讨有氧运动干预对抑郁模型大鼠海马VEGF表达及空间学习记忆能力的影响。方法选用30只3月龄成年Sprague-Dawley大鼠,体重300±20 g。适应性饲养1周后,随机分为3组:对照组(C)、模型组(M)、运动组(E), M组和E组根据造模过程不同,分别进行4周的CUMS刺激和/或有氧运动。运动或CUMS后,采用蔗糖偏好测验(SPT)和Morris水迷宫(MWZ)测试行为指标。ELISA法检测全脑5-HT表达。Real-time PCR、Western Blotting、HE染色、免疫荧光法检测海马组织中VEGF表达及形态结构变化。结果与C组比较,cms诱导的抑郁大鼠蔗糖摄取量和糖浆偏好百分比明显降低,全脑5-HT抑郁明显降低,海马神经元排列紊乱,数量减少,海马VEGF基因和蛋白明显降低。而有氧运动可以显著改善抑郁症大鼠的抑郁样行为、学习记忆能力,增加全脑5-HT的表达,使海马神经元排列整齐、清晰、大量,增加海马中VEGF基因和蛋白的表达。结论四周有氧运动干预可显著上调海马血管内皮生长因子表达,改善学习记忆能力和抑郁症状。提示VEGF在海马中的表达增加可能是抑郁和空间学习记忆能力的神经生物学机制之一。

PO-079 Effect of Aerobic Exercise on the expression of VEGF in hippocampus and the Spatial Learning and Memorizing Abilities in CUMS-induced depressive Rats
Objective Through the 4 weeks aerobic exercise intervention in rats with CUMS (chronic unpredictable mild stress) to build depression model of rats, and to explore the effects of aerobic exercise intervention on hippocampal VEGF expression and spatial learning and memorizing ability in depressive model rats. Methods 30 adult 3-month-old Sprague-Dawley rats weighing 300 ± 20 g were used. After adaptive feeding for 1 week, they were randomly divided into 3 groups: control group (C), the model group (M), and exercise group (E). M and E groups were subjected to CUMS stimulation for 4 weeks and/or aerobic exercise for 4 weeks according to different modeling procedures. After exercise or CUMS, the behavioral index was tested by sucrose preference test (SPT) and Morris water maze (MWZ). The 5-HT expression of whole brain was detected by ELISA. And Real-time PCR, Western Blotting, HE staining and immunofluorescence method test the expression of VEGF and morphological structure to change in hippocampus. Results Compared with the C group, the sucrose intake and the percentage of syrup preference were significantly decreased in the CUMS-induced depression rats, the 5-HT depression in the whole brain was significantly decreased, the hippocampal neurons were disorderly arranged and the number was less, and the hippocampal VEGF gene and protein were significantly decreased. While aerobic exercise can significantly improve the depression-like behavior, learning and memorizing ability of rats with depression, increase the expression of 5-HT in whole brain, and the hippocampal neurons are arranged neatly, clearly and in large quantities, and increase the gene and protein expression of VEGF in hippocampus. Conclusions Four weeks aerobic exercise intervention can significantly up-regulate the expression of VEGF in hippocampus and improve learning and memorizing ability and depressive symptoms. It was suggested that the increased expression of VEGF in the hippocampus may be one of the neurobiological mechanisms in depression and spatial learning and memorizing ability.
